I've got a 92 Sentra Se-r for sale
SR20DE FWD, 5speed manual, NO 5th gear pop-out

2nd USDM motor in vehicle currently, also replaced 5speed tranny during original build of the car.
Engine runs very well when jump started. Vehicle needs a new battery and more than likely a new negative battery cable. Also needs a new brake master cylinder. Needs new struts.

Vehicle is not in daily driver condition currenly. She took serious damage during the hail storm on Memorial Day 2008 and was set aside as a future project. I've just decided to let her go.

Typical sentra rust was decently repaired 2 years ago and she was painted black with blue pearl. Paint is NOT in good condition.

GOOD STUFF:
Motor runs well
Has a gorgeous Last Generation SSAC exhaust header considered to be the best mass produced header for the FWD SR20 engine.
New rear glass
7500 rpm redline, pulls very hard to redline, very fun car when driving well
Viscous LSD from the factory, limited slip still functioning
Decent Yokohama AVS ES100s on vehicle

Vehicle also comes with stock wheels painted charcoal, in very good condition, with dunlop snow tires that only have one season on them.
I am willing to sell the stock wheels with snow tires seperately, $100

I'm looking to get $750 for this car
I'll be sad to see her go

I may consider trades as well, 98-01 2.5RS parts, Fishing equipment, throw ideas at me

I plan to put current condition pics up tomorrow

Jordan



I suppose I didn't relate that the other problems I listed add to her lack of daily driveability. Needs a new brake master and struts. Due to crummy battery and negative cable, it dies when you pull the jumpers off. Easy fix though

And the hail damage is REALLY bad. Seriously



some pics from tonight. I want this thing gone! Somebody needs a good running FWD SR20 with a perfect tranny!
These trannys are very tough to come by without 5th gear popout. I havent seen one of these trannys for sale for less than 5-600 bucks for a few years.
With new shocks, a new battery and the new master cylinder installed she is a really fun little car, despite the body damage.
